ABSTRACT

Public speaking is a common fear among individuals, and it

often begins during adolescence. This research aims to explore

the fear of public speaking among Grade 11 students at Santa Rosa

National High School. By understanding the underlying causes and

effects of this fear, educators and school administrators can

implement effective strategies to support students in overcoming

their and developing vital communication skills.

This study employs a qualitative research design, utilizing

interviews to gather data from selected Grade 11 students. The

findings will shed light on the factors contributing public

speaking phobia, such as self-confidence, social anxiety, and a

lack of experience. The results will provide valuable insights

into the students' perspectives. The research study may also help

to devise targeted interventions to alleviate public speaking

anxiety and promote students' overall personal and academic

growth.

Review of Related Literature

According to Breakey, L.(2005), on her study “Fear of public

speaking-the role of the SLP” Although there are some individuals

who have a true phobia of speaking in a public forum, public

speaking is usually near the top of any list of activities that

most individuals dislike, fear, or avoid. Such non-phobic

speakers are the subjects of this article. It describes some

basic causes for these fears; considers evaluative and treatment

procedures; and provides a rationale for the involvement of the

speech-language pathologist in “wellness” management.
